What does the SQ3R in SQ3R reading system stand for?
The letters in SQ3R stand for five steps: survey, question, read, recite, and review.
Why is SQ3R an effective reading strategy?
SQ3R is especially beneficial to readers because: It activates knowledge and thinking about the text even before the student begins reading. It allows the student to review information as he is learning it. It creates study guides students can use to review for tests.How do you use SQ3R in the classroom?

What are the disadvantages of SQ3R?
- Students must artificially repeat the SQ3R process until it becomes automatic.
- The method is time-intensive as it requires you to dedicate enough time to comprehend each chapter and analyze all headings.
- The SQ3R method can be difficult to learn and apply.

Why is it important to apply the SQ3R technique in academic literacy?
SQ3R is five-step technique that you can use to learn more effectively, and to increase your retention of written information. It helps you to focus what you need from a document, and to create a clear structure for the information in your mind.
Is SQ3R effective Quora?
The SQ3R method of reading is an excellent framework for developing metacognition (thinking about your own thinking and learning); and metacognition is a big part of what separates good readers from poor readers! Good readers do things like SQ3R ‘self talk’ and ‘self teaching’ automatically.
When using the SQ3R method for reading a text what should you do after you have previewed the whole passage?
After reading the entire text or sections, recite the answers to the questions you posed, as well as the important points and/or main ideas. Your goal should be to answer your questions and recite important information from memory. Verbalize important points, ideas or passages in your own words.

When can I apply SQ3R?
SQ3R takes time and is not a strategy that can be employed or used effectively the night before a test. Plan to read each chapter before it’s discussed in class. Doing this will make the class lecture a review. It is also likely to help you to understand the material that is presented in class at a deeper level.
